Story
Set on the backdrop of Kondaveedu town, the story is about Gabbar Singh (Pawan Kalyan) a fearless and honest cop who likes to be an anti-hero but with a good cause. Neglected by his father (Nagineedu), Gabbar Singh has a mind of his own.
